Summary: | The invention relates to an equipment meant to be used for warning and protecting industrial objectives in case of earthquake. According to the invention, the equipment (E) comprises a block (1) for acquiring data from seismic stations or data servers (S1...Sn), a block (2) for analyzing data, in order to detect and make a decision based on acceleration levels in relation with pre-established thresholds, a local seismic switch formed of an analogue sensor (3) and an interface (4) for conversion into synchronized digital signal by GPS (7), a relay block (5) which is actuated depending on the decision of the block (2) and which, depending on acceleration or magnitude, controls electric valves, an acoustic lighting tower (9), and ensures local information on a display (10), the equipment additionally comprising a GSM block (8), which ensures the data communication as reserve able to replace the internet cable connection, as well as a supply block (11).
